U.S. Air Power Revives Urgently Wanted Cancelled Hypersonic Missile After Years of Failures and Delays

The U.S. Air Power has revived the AGM-183A Air-Launched Speedy Response Weapon (ARRW) program, after growth was cancelled in 2023 resulting from severe delays and a number of failed flight assessments. In its Fiscal yr 2027 funds request, the U.S. Air Power requested over $296 million to help the event of the missile, which was designed as a two stage boost-glide hypersonic weapon. The missile makes use of a rocket booster to speed up a non-powered hypersonic glide car glider to optimum velocity and altitude, after which the car flies in direction of its goal alongside a shallow in-atmosphere flight path. Initially developed as an air-to-ground missile for hanging fastened targets, this system’s objectives have now been altered to deal with offering anti-shipping capabilities, offering the U.S. Armed Forces with their first hypersonic anti-ship missile.

AGM-183 Hypersonic Missile Prototype Carried By B-52 Bomber

The U.S. Air Power has introduced that it intends to combine missiles developed below the ARRW program onto the B-52 and B-1 bombers, whereas including that different kinds of plane might also combine it sooner or later. The F-15EX fighter, which is by far the heaviest and has the best weapons carrying capability of any Western fighter sort, is taken into account a number one candidate to combine the missiles. Whereas the AGM-183 was initially developed to assault stationary targets, reaching an anti-shipping functionality would require the mixing of a terminal steerage system to have interaction shifting targets corresponding to adversary destroyers. Because the U.S. Navy’s floor and submarine fleets have more and more been outmatched each technologically and numerically by new generations of Chinese language ships, the brand new missile program has the potential to permit aviation property to play a a lot higher position in focusing on adversary transport to assist compensate for this.

The event of the AGM-183A was beforehand thought-about probably the most promising packages to assist slender the USA’ hypersonic missile hole with China, Russia and North Korea, which have all for years fielded missiles with superior hypersonic glide autos. Iran and Russia are the one international locations to have used such glide autos in fight, with Russia in late 2024 testing its new Oreshnik system in opposition to Ukrainian targets, whereas Iran in March 2026 used the Fattah 2 in opposition to targets in Israel. The AGM-183A had been reported canceled in March 2023 resulting from technical points, earlier than reportedly being revived because of the lack of viable different packages, and subsequently being once more dropped from the Pentagon funds in March 2024. One prototype was launched from a B-52 bomber over Guam on March 17, 2024.
